Story about this quilt:
This was made in December of 2022 with half square triangles (HSTs) left over from the Woodworking Memories quilts. It was a real challenge to avoid over-thinking and trying to “match” lines or colors. Each unit is made of half square triangles (HSTs), a light and a dark triangle.
I designed and made the piece and quilted it in a grid with clear thread. The border is quilted with straight parallel lines to simulate a picture frame. There are 90 HSTs in the body of the piece. The edge is finished with a facing that has triangular pockets in the top corners to hold the wooden hanger that my husband made.
